10 Celebrity New Year Resolutions for 2022

1.Actor Sonu Sood:

“There are no resolutions for the new year. I suppose I have been trying to make new resolutions every day for many years, with two years of experience dealing with the common man and assisting others. My New Year’s resolution, I believe, should be to link people, to inspire and be inspired by them, and to engage them in some type of good activity. As a result, we can change more and more lives. That’s something I’d like to accomplish in the new year and in the years ahead.”

2.Actor/Director Adivi Sesh:

“Perhaps this moment in time is a great reminder that nothing is permanent. It’s important to stop and smell the roses once in a while. I hope to live a little, laugh a lot and love like there’s no tomorrow.”

3.Actress Daisy Bopanna:

“Be more self-conscious and observant of others. I want to be aware of my own behaviours and take responsibility for my choices. I’m not a big fan of making resolutions, but since the beginning of 2018, I’ve been trying to be more self-aware. There is a lot of commotion in social media today, and it is always good and bad. So, I believe that being aware of everything helps us improve year after year.”

4.Miss India Earth 2014, Alankrita Sahai:

“My resolve is to be kinder to myself and more conscious of how I spend my time and energy. To be able to love freely and to live a psychologically, emotionally, and physically healthy existence. Spend less time with devices and people that deplete my energy. Healthy connections should be nurtured. Also, read all of the novels that are published this year.”

5.Actor Sunny Hinduja:

“This year, I want everything to be smooth and uncomplicated for everyone. I want to concentrate on my own and my loved ones’ physical, mental, and emotional well-being.”

6.Actor Ranjit Punia:

“This year, I’m looking forward to acting in some fantastic films and preparing for some memorable parts. All I wish for is for everyone to be kind to one another.”

7.IPS Anjani Kumar:

“Every year, I make and violate the resolution to avoid sweets. I have a sweet tooth, but I’m hoping to renew my goal to quit eating sweets in the new year and stick to it this time!”

8.Actress Tanya Choudhary:

My goal for 2022 is to make a modest impact in someone’s life on a daily basis, because not everyone is happy all of the time. People nowadays are going through a lot. As the saying goes, “If you’re feeling down, the only way you can go is up.” My new year’s resolution is to bring modest yet good changes in people’s lives.

9.Actress Digangana Suryavanshi

I did make a promise to myself this year – that I’m going to try to be better and better every single day. I hope I keep up with it.

10.Actor Nani:

“Especially after 2020 and the pandemic I don’t want to think about tomorrow or the day after or the future. I just want to live every single day and be happy. I want to be with friends and family and be good above everything else.”

Is the Telugu Film Industry Taking Over Bollywood?

Introduction: For decades, Bollywood held the lion’s share of Indian cinema’s spotlight. However, in recent years, a significant shift has occurred and it’s unmistakable. The Telugu film industry (Tollywood) is not just holding its own; it’s leading from the front, dominating pan-India box offices, winning international recognition, and giving rise to a new wave of superstar directors and culturally rooted blockbusters. From ‘RRR’ to the upcoming ‘Pushpa 2’, Telugu cinema is no longer just regional, it’s national, even global. Box Office Boom: Numbers Don’t Lie Telugu films are now commanding unmatched collections both in India and overseas: ‘RRR’ (2022) by S.S. Rajamouli: Grossed over ₹1,200 crore worldwide Won an Oscar for Best Original Song (“Naatu Naatu”), putting Indian mass cinema on the global map Created hysteria in Japan, USA, and even the West Indies ‘Pushpa: The Rise’ (2021) by Sukumar: Broke records with over ₹360 crore gross on a modest budget Its dialogues and songs became viral across languages Pushpa 2: The Rule is already creating massive pre-release hype with deals crossing ₹100 crore+ in Hindi rights alone The Winning Formula: Mass, Emotion, and Craft Telugu films have found the sweet spot between mass action, emotional depth, and visual grandeur. They don’t just aim to entertain they immerse audiences in rich storytelling rooted in local culture, yet universally relatable. It’s a formula that Bollywood, in its struggle to reconnect with a broader audience, is now trying to replicate. Visionary Directors Turned National Icons Names like S.S. Rajamouli, Sukumar, Trivikram Srinivas, and Prashanth Neel have become synonymous with scale, innovation, and success. Their storytelling is rooted in emotion but mounted on ambitious canvases and that blend is exactly what audiences are demanding across India. Top 10 Marathi Actors Shaping the Silver Screen

Marathi cinema continues to flourish thanks to a vibrant mix of seasoned veterans and emerging talent. These actors, through compelling performances in theatre, television, and film, have profoundly impacted the industry. Here’s a spotlight on some of the most influential figures today: 1. Swapnil Joshi Fondly regarded as the “Shah Rukh Khan of Marathi cinema,” Swapnil Joshi is a superstar whose versatility has wooed audiences across mediums. He rose to prominence with hits like Mumbai-Pune-Mumbai and its sequel, while his television work (Eka Lagnachi Dusri Goshta) also earned widespread acclaim. Joshi’s charismatic screen presence and consistent box-office success make him a pillar of the industry. 2. Ankush Chaudhari A multi-faceted talent—actor, writer, producer, and director—Ankush Chaudhari earned fame through the romantic hit Double Seat and further cemented his appeal with Dhurala, Daagdi Chaawl 2, and others. Honored with Filmfare Awards in the category of Best Actor for Double Seat and Dhurala, his commitment to quality storytelling places him among the elite 3. Subodh Bhave An actor, director, and writer of considerable repute, Subodh Bhave shines in both historical and modern narratives. His portrayal of freedom fighter Bal Gangadhar Tilak, in Lokmanya: Ek Yugpurush, garnered widespread praise His nuanced performance in the Zee Marathi TV series Tula Pahate Re further underscores his versatility 4. Sachit Patil Multi-talented as an actor, director, and playwright, Sachit Patil broke through with the 2010 hit Zenda and seamlessly transitioned from television to impactful film roles in Aboli and Tu Chandane Shimpit Jashi His deep understanding of character and narrative structure enriches the projects he selects. 5.
